In session

In session

Bewdley's Molly Ann showcases a unique blend of vocals, piano, 'electronics' and strings together with a love for strong melodies.
Ìý
She's influenced by fellow ±«Óãtv Introducing discoveries such as Florence + The Machine, Gabriella Aplin, Rae Morris and Herefordshire's Ellie Goulding.
Ìý
We loved her music so much, we passed it on to Mark Forrest who played it on the Best of ±«Óãtv Introducing across all 40 Local Radio stationsÌýin Britain.

Tributes

Tributes

The R&B and soul singer Ben E King - best known for Stand By Me - has died, aged 76.
Ìý
He was also in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all Of Fame for his time with The Drifters.
Ìý
Clyde Spencer, who lives in Droitwich is one of the original Drifters.
Ìý
He's been paying tribute to the singer.

1 - 3 May: Troyfest, Hay-on-Wye

1 - 3 May: Troyfest, Hay-on-Wye
Now in its fourth year, Troyfest takes places over three days and nights in and around a stunning country mansion near Hereford and the English/Welsh border.
Ìý
They've booked more than 80 bands and DJs to play on 5 stages at Baskerville Hall.
Ìý
There'll be an outdoor AV show, an indoor swimming pool, showers and indoor toilets!

±«Óãtv Introducing in Hereford

±«Óãtv Introducing in Hereford

Throughout May, all of our live sessions were performed in the studio - the Studio Theatre at The Courtyard in Hereford, that is!
Ìý
As well as regular music nights in both there and the Main House, the centre is home to the Music Pool charity and hosts regular Jazz Cafe events in the bar area along with various open mic nights.
Ìý
The glass-fronted building, on Edgar Street, officially opened in 1998 on the site of its predecessor and before that it used to be a swimming pool!

How To Make It In The Music Industry: The Boomtown Rats

How To Make It In The Music Industry: The Boomtown Rats
We started off the year with a brand new series of 'How To Make It In The Music Industry' with Hereford's Sean Denny, who runs his own record label at Sony Records in London.
Ìý
This week, we continue to talk you through the whole signing process with a case study that is right on our doorstep.
Ìý
Garrick Roberts is the guitarist and founding member of the Boomtown Rats and lives in Bromyard.
Ìý
It's taken us three years to persuade him to give away his secrets of how his band attracted the attention of managers, record labels and studio producers - and how they insisted the band retained full creative control of their music.Ìý
